Lumines Live! [a] is a 2006 puzzle video game developed by Q Entertainment for the Xbox 360. It was released worldwide in October 2006 and in Japan in March 2007. The objective of the game is to move and rotate 2×2 blocks to form colored squares of the same color. Points are awarded to the player when the Time Line erases the colored squares.

Qwirkle is a tile-based game for two to four players, designed by Susan McKinley Ross and published by MindWare in 2006. Qwirkle shares some characteristics with the games Rummikub and Scrabble. It is distributed in Canada by game and puzzle company Outset Media. Qwirkle is considered by MindWare to be its most awarded game of all time. [1]
QBillion (キュービリオン) [2] is a puzzle video game for the original Nintendo Game Boy.It was released by SETA Corporation in 1990.. In QBillion, you control a mouse that, for reasons that are left unclear, has to reduce stacks of blocks to units one block high. [2]
